About Benton House of Johns Creek
Welcome to Benton House of Johns Creek! A beautiful community of warmth decorated with fine furnishings, stunning artwork and more often than not the scent of something delicious baking in the kitchen. A place where independence thrives but help is just a call away.
Benton House of Johns Creek enjoys a full community life with monthly parties and a customized social calendar! Resident’s enjoy daily exercise options with a certified fitness instructor, concerts, trips, religious services, cooking classes and more for our residents’ preference! We also offer a variety of apartment styles in Assisted Living including models with patio options overlooking the scenic Johns Creek Webb Bridge Park! It’s a perfect place to read a book or enjoy a bird feeder.
Our bright and exclusive Beacon Neighborhood has higher staffing ratios and a dedicated coordinator to serve residents with memory loss. Residents bring their own furnishing and keepsakes so the apartments can truly be their own.
Benton House of Johns Creek offers a full array of services including medication assistance, enjoyable meals, housekeeping and dignified personal assistance by a qualified staff. We value choice and dignity providing a caring environment where friendships can flourish. When you’re here you’re home!
